Warriors open states with win over Menehune
Gareth Gomez scored in the 44th minute for the match's lone goal to lead Kamehameha over Moanalua 1-0 as the JN Automotive/HHSAA Division I Boys Soccer State Tournament opened yesterday at the Waipio Peninsula Soccer Park.
The Warriors advance to today's 5 p.m. match against third-seeded Kealakehe.
The other three first-round matches were equally close: Kaiser shut out Waiakea 2-0; Aiea edged Baldwin 1-0; and Roosevelt went to penalty kicks to score a 1-0 win over Castle.
In Division II, Ian Lactaotao scored four goals and Chance Bukoski two in Kapaa's 8-0 rout of McKinley.
In other matches, Hawaii Prep blanked Kailua 3-0; Kamehameha-Hawaii shut out Farrington 3-0; and Kauai held off Christian Liberty 4-2.
